Maybe it was a lousy analogy or maybe you just don't get it because you're a cheapskate who sits on his money instead of using them to enjoy life. Dunno.
But a Bugatti Veyron and some 5 dollar Toyota "perform the same tasks" as much a Virtual DJ and $4000 worth of proper DJ gear do but some people still buy the Bugatti or the proper DJ gear
I dunno about others, but for me this is a hobby and a hobby only. I enjoy mixing with my hardware gear while I couldn't care less about mixing with Virtual DJ. So I've spent thousands on my gear, just to have fun and enjoy life really. Some people spend that money on fast cars or something else, I've spent it on music and music gear. Also some people want more out of DJing than a hobby. For them playing at home with Virtual DJ makes no sense as when they'd get a gig and would have to use proper gear they wouldn't know what the fuck to do so for them the thousands spent on gear might actually be a good investment.
